Transaction 43d292ac116ac18bc526e42eda78815c1e4a21e63bf79de317abda79502b94b1
1 Input
1 Output
-
43d292ac116ac18bc526e42eda78815c1e4a21e63bf79de317abda79502b94b1:0
- value
- 465320
- script pubkey
- OP_0 OP_PUSHBYTES_20 3daca44eb345002a0defa13aeea9d9cb74a2d61e
- address
- bc1q8kk2gn4ng5qz5r005yawa2weed6294s7vufec5